Hortense R. Greene; Former Restaurant Owner
Hortense (Kay) R. Greene, a longtime Santa Paula resident and former restaurant owner, died Thursday in an Oxnard Hospital. She was 77.
Mrs. Greene owned the Ribley restaurant in Santa Paula for several years and was also an active member of the American Assn. of Retired Persons. She also attended Our Lady of Guadalupe Church.
She is survived by her husband, Martin Greene of Santa Paula; a sister, Ronnie Tipton of Santa Paula; and two brothers, Augustine Reyes and Gilbert Delao, both of Santa Paula.
A rosary will be said at 7 p.m. Tuesday at Our Lady of Guadalupe Church. Mass will be said at the church at 9 a.m. Wednesday, with the Rev. Renee Juarez officiating. Burial follows in Santa Paula Cemetery.
Funeral arrangements are under the direction of Skillin-Carroll Mortuary in Santa Paula.
